Jan Baczewski

Polish political and educational activist in Germany

Jan Baczewski is a human[1]. He was born in Gryźliny[2]. He was born on December 13, 1890[3]. He died in Gdańsk[4]. He died on June 20, 1958[5]. He worked as a politician[6].
